Signed-off-by: Stéphane Jacob <sj@m4x.org>
$user = User::getSilent($email);
// Wrong email and no user: failure.
$user = User::getSilent($email);
// Wrong email and no user: failure.
- if (is_null($user) && !$is_valid_email) {
+ if (is_null($user) && (!$is_valid_email || !User::isForeignEmailAddress($email))) {
$page->trigError('« <strong>' . $email . '</strong> » n\'est pas une adresse email valide.');
return;
}
$page->trigError('« <strong>' . $email . '</strong> » n\'est pas une adresse email valide.');
return;
}